Abstract

A number of variations may include a product comprising: an electrochemical device comprising an anode and a cathode, and at least one sensor comprising a plurality of strain sensing components and at least one temperature sensing component wherein each of the anode and the cathode comprises at least one strain sensing component comprising an optical fiber comprising at least one grating, wherein the at least one sensor is constructed and arranged to provide measurements that derive both state of charge and temperature of the anode and the cathode simultaneously.
